cd $(dirname $0) ; CWD=$(pwd)

PKGNAM=mlocate
VERSION=${VERSION:-$(echo $PKGNAM-*.tar.xz | rev | cut -f 3- -d . | cut -f 1 -d - | rev)}
BUILD=${BUILD:-4}

# Automatically determine the architecture we're building on:
if [ -z "$ARCH" ]; then
  case "$(uname -m)" in
    i?86) ARCH=i586 ;;
    arm*) readelf /usr/bin/file -A | egrep -q "Tag_CPU.*[4,5]" && ARCH=arm || ARCH=armv7hl ;;
    # Unless $ARCH is already set, use uname -m for all other archs:
    *) ARCH=$(uname -m) ;;
  esac
  export ARCH
fi

# If the variable PRINT_PACKAGE_NAME is set, then this script will report what
# the name of the created package would be, and then exit. This information
# could be useful to other scripts.
if [ ! -z "${PRINT_PACKAGE_NAME}" ]; then
  echo "$PKGNAM-$VERSION-$ARCH-$BUILD.txz"
  exit 0
fi

NUMJOBS=${NUMJOBS:-" -j$(expr $(nproc) + 1) "}

if [ "$ARCH" = "i586" ]; then
  SLKCFLAGS="-O2 -march=i586 -mtune=i686"
  LIBDIRSUFFIX=""
elif [ "$ARCH" = "i686" ]; then
  SLKCFLAGS="-O2 -march=i686"
  LIBDIRSUFFIX=""
elif [ "$ARCH" = "s390" ]; then
  SLKCFLAGS="-O2"
  LIBDIRSUFFIX=""
elif [ "$ARCH" = "x86_64" ]; then
  SLKCFLAGS="-O2 -fPIC"
  LIBDIRSUFFIX="64"
elif [ "$ARCH" = "armv7hl" ]; then
  SLKCFLAGS="-O3 -march=armv7-a -mfpu=vfpv3-d16"
  LIBDIRSUFFIX=""
else
  SLKCFLAGS="-O2"
  LIBDIRSUFFIX=""
fi

TMP=${TMP:-/tmp}
PKG=$TMP/package-$PKGNAM

rm -rf $PKG
mkdir -p $TMP $PKG

cd $TMP
rm -rf $PKGNAM-$VERSION
tar xvf $CWD/$PKGNAM-$VERSION.tar.xz || exit 1
cd $PKGNAM-$VERSION || exit 1

chown -R root:root .
find . \
  \( -perm 777 -o -perm 775 -o -perm 711 -o -perm 555 -o -perm 511 \) \
  -exec chmod 755 {} \+ -o \
  \( -perm 666 -o -perm 664 -o -perm 600 -o -perm 444 -o -perm 440 -o -perm 400 \) \
  -exec chmod 644 {} \+

# Configure:
CFLAGS="$SLKCFLAGS" \
./configure \
  --prefix=/usr \
  --sysconfdir=/etc \
  --libdir=/usr/lib${LIBDIRSUFFIX} \
  --localstatedir=/var/lib \
  --mandir=/usr/man \
  --build=$ARCH-slackware-linux || exit 1

# Build and install:
make $NUMJOBS groupname=slocate || make groupname=slocate || exit 1
make install DESTDIR=$PKG || exit 1

mkdir -p $PKG/etc
cp -a $CWD/updatedb.conf.new $PKG/etc/updatedb.conf.new
chown root:root $PKG/etc/updatedb.conf.new
chmod 644 $PKG/etc/updatedb.conf.new

mv $PKG/usr/bin/locate $PKG/usr/bin/mlocate
( cd $PKG/usr/bin ; ln -sf mlocate locate )

( cd $PKG/usr/man/man1
  ln -sf locate.1 mlocate.1
)

mkdir -p $PKG/usr/libexec
cp -a $CWD/mlocate-run-updatedb $PKG/usr/libexec/mlocate-run-updatedb
chown root:root $PKG/usr/libexec/mlocate-run-updatedb
chmod 755 $PKG/usr/libexec/mlocate-run-updatedb

mkdir -p $PKG/etc/cron.daily
cp -a $CWD/mlocate.cron $PKG/etc/cron.daily/mlocate
chown root:root $PKG/etc/cron.daily/mlocate
chmod 755 $PKG/etc/cron.daily/mlocate

chown root:slocate $PKG/usr/bin/mlocate
chmod 2711 $PKG/usr/bin/mlocate
mkdir -p $PKG/var/lib/mlocate
chown root:slocate $PKG/var/lib/mlocate
chmod 750 $PKG/var/lib/mlocate

# Strip binaries:
( cd $PKG
  find . | xargs file | grep "executable" | grep ELF | cut -f 1 -d : | xargs strip --strip-unneeded 2> /dev/null
  find . | xargs file | grep "shared object" | grep ELF | cut -f 1 -d : | xargs strip --strip-unneeded 2> /dev/null
)

# Compress and link manpages, if any:
if [ -d $PKG/usr/man ]; then
  ( cd $PKG/usr/man
    for manpagedir in $(find . -type d -name "man*") ; do
      ( cd $manpagedir
        for eachpage in $( find . -type l -maxdepth 1 | grep -v '\.gz$') ; do
          ln -s $( readlink $eachpage ).gz $eachpage.gz
          rm $eachpage
        done
        gzip -9 *.?
      )
    done
  )
fi

# Add a documentation directory:
mkdir -p $PKG/usr/doc/${PKGNAM}-$VERSION
cp -a \
  ABOUT-NLS AUTHORS COPYING* ChangeLog INSTALL NEWS README* \
  $PKG/usr/doc/${PKGNAM}-$VERSION

# If there's a ChangeLog, installing at least part of the recent history
# is useful, but don't let it get totally out of control:
if [ -r ChangeLog ]; then
  DOCSDIR=$(echo $PKG/usr/doc/${PKGNAM}-$VERSION)
  cat ChangeLog | head -n 1000 > $DOCSDIR/ChangeLog
  touch -r ChangeLog $DOCSDIR/ChangeLog
fi


mkdir -p $PKG/install
zcat $CWD/doinst.sh.gz > $PKG/install/doinst.sh
cat $CWD/slack-desc > $PKG/install/slack-desc

cd $PKG
/sbin/makepkg -l y -c n $TMP/$PKGNAM-$VERSION-$ARCH-$BUILD.txz
